Neuropathic pain is commonly referred to as a nerve injury or nerve impairment and is usually associated with allodynia. Alloydnia is often a central pain sensitization That could be a results of repetitive non-painful stimulation on the receptors. It triggers a pain reaction from a stimulus which is deemed as non-painful in standard disorders, resulting from sensitization procedure from said repetitive stimulation. This ailment is usually described as “pathologic” pain, due to the fact neuropathic pain actually serves no function with regards to defense system for our overall body, along with the pain could be in the shape of continuous sensation or episodic incidents.
